Hornet 5000i versions are designed for use under DOS based
systems and should be used by those users who do not have Windows
available on their PC systems. The two versions listed above are
equivalent in product feature and operation and constitute the
latest version available. The two versions provide the following
operational options:
This version requires the standard Hornet 5000i
Security Key fitted to the PC in order to operate (the security keys
are clearly labelled). This type of Security Key will not operate
the newer Hornet Windmill systems and you will need to
either fit a new key or upgrade the system to Version 6.4.2j. (Nov
'95)
This version requires the newer Hornet Windmill
Security Key fitted to the PC in order to operate and hence this
version allows a user to operate both Hornet 5000i and Hornet
Windmill systems on the same PC under a single key. Users
registered under a current Support Scheme Contract may request an
update to this release as part of an upgrade to Hornet Windmill.
(Apr '96)
Note on Project Data File Formats
Hornet Windmill versions 7.2 will automatically
convert existing Hornet 5000i project data for use under the
new system; once converted project data should not be run with a
Hornet 5000i system.
Hornet Windmill versions 7.3 (32 bit) will not convert
existing Hornet 5000i project data directly; please
contact Hornet
Support for advice if you require this facility.
Hornet 5000i will convert any project data from earlier Hornet
5000 systems; once converted project data cannot be run with a
Hornet 5000 system. All Hornet Windmill versions
will not convert existing Hornet 5000 project data
directly; please contact Hornet
Support for advice if you require this facility.
